Choosing the Right Baby Skincare Essentials
Gentle Cleaners and Moisturizers
- Coconut‑oil‑based cleansers: Soft enough for newborns, yet effective at removing dirt. Shea butter moisturizers: Rich, non‑greasy, and perfect for preventing diaper rash. Aloe vera gel: Calms irritation and soothes after bath time.
Bath Time Must‑Haves
- Silicone bath mitts: Protect delicate hands while scrubbing. Temperature‑controlled bath thermometer: Keeps the water at a safe 37°C (98.6°F). Soft, cotton hooded towels: Wrap the baby in a cloud of comfort.
Safety First: Non‑Toxic Products
“Safety is not a feature; it’s a standard.” – Dr. Emily Hart, Pediatric Dermatologist
Choosing products free of parabens, sulfates, and fragrances guarantees that the baby’s skin won’t react. Look for certifications like “USDA Organic” or “Dermatologically Tested.”
Packaging Ideas That Wow
Reusable Baskets vs. Eco‑Friendly Boxes
Reusable wicker baskets give a rustic, timeless feel, while biodegradable paper boxes add a modern eco‑conscious twist. Either option can be lined with tissue paper in pastel hues to create a soft, inviting interior.
Personalization Touches
- Custom labels: Add the baby’s name or a sweet note. Hand‑written card: A quick “Congratulations” goes a long way. Small gift card: A voucher to a local baby store lets the parents pick what they need next.
